Haiti - Agriculture : 11,6 million euros to support agricultural production

Wednesday, two financing conventions were signed between Wilson Laleau, Minister of Economy and Finance and the French Development Agency (AFD) in the presence of the Ambassador of France and the acting Chargé d'affaires of the Union European.

This financing will enable the implementation of a large project to support agricultural production and food security (SECAL) in the Southern Department. For a toital amount of 11,670,000 euros, this funding complete the 4.5 milliions euros already granted to SECAL project in July 2012.

The project "will help increase agricultural production of corn, eggs and plantains and reduce rural poverty through better redistribution of added value for producers."

Farmers, ill be supported through several actions. For bananas sector in the Department of West, the project will address two main constraints of production: irrigation management and disease control. In the South, the Avezac irrigation system will be restored and the irrigators associations supported to promote better management of water resources. Corn producers will receive subsidies in the form of vouchers for seeds, plowing and fertilizers. Finally, the egg producers will receive for their part advice for access to funding and technical support.

A part of the production will be provided to school canteens in the South under the National School Feeding Programme. Tens of thousands of students will benefit from an improved corn and egg meal.

The plain of Les Cayes, located in the Southern Department, has been identified as a priority area of ​​intervention by the Ministry of Agriculture, Natural Resources and Rural Development (MARNDR) for the implementation of the project SECAL. With more than 200,000 inhabitants and 20,000 hectares of arable land, it is one of the most important areas of the country of maize production.

The project will be managed by the Departmental Directorate Agricultural South (SADD), a decentralized structure of the Ministry of Agriculture.
